Detailed Comparison

MetricMarketing associate professionalsOther managers and proprietorsDifference
Median Annual£29,998£39,250-£9,252
Mean Annual£33,536£44,546-£11,010
Monthly£2,500£3,271-£771
Weekly£577£755-£178
Hourly£14.42£18.87-£4.45

Salary Range Comparison

PercentileMarketing associate professionalsOther managers and proprietors
10th (Entry)£14,224£24,003
25th£24,999£30,911
50th (Median)£29,998£39,250
75th£38,164£52,076
90th (Senior)£49,931£69,780
